Experience gain in a party
by Blazur | 08/08/2011 22:03:56![]() I asked this question before but never got an answer. Say 4 people are playing together consistently, and remain relatively close together throughout. Will all 4 players gain experience at the same rate, or is it in any way possible one player could advance beyond the others? by Zarhym | 08/08/2011 22:12:09![]()
If you're far from your party while they're slaughtering dudes, you won't get experience for the kills. So long as you stick together, your experience gains should be equivalent. We've toyed with the idea of having an experience bonus affix, but we're not sure whether or not that's something good for the game. Where all my honey gone? Pooh bear be cryin'... |

by Zarhym | 08/08/2011 22:46:52![]()
The way it works now, if you are dead when a boss is killed you will miss out on experience and loot. We want to make sure the design isn't such that it becomes a standard for high-level characters to carry low-level characters through content, without risk of penalty should the lowbie die. But, there is a new resurrection mechanic which allows other players in the party to click on a dead player's corpse to bring them back on the spot, rather than having them be sent back to town. We'll see how gameplay elements such as these play out in the beta test and adjust accordingly if necessary. ;) Where all my honey gone? Pooh bear be cryin'... |
